Other connections
Switching components on and off using
the 12 volt trigger
You can connect a component in your system (such as a
screen or projector) to this receiver so that it switches on
or off using a 12 volt trigger when you select an input
function. However, you must specify which input
functions switch on the trigger using the The Input Setup
menu on page 58. Note that this will only work with
components that have a standby mode.

Connect the 12V TRIGGER jack of this receiver to
the 12V trigger of another component.
Use a cable with a mono mini-plug on each end for the
connection.
• The trigger maximum power is DC OUT 12V/50mA.
After you've specified the input functions that will switch
on the trigger, you'll be able to switch the component on
or off just by pressing the input function(s) you've set in
The Input Setup menu on page 58.

Important
• If you connect to a Pioneer plasma display using an
SR+ cable, you will need to point the remote control
at the plasma display remote sensor to control the
receiver. In this case, you won't be able to control the
receiver using the remote control if you switch the
plasma display off.
• Before you can use the extra SR+ features, you need
to make a few settings in the receiver. See The Input
Setup menu on page 58 and Multi-Room and IR
receiver setup on page 59 for detailed instructions.
